The Planning Board recommended that several affordable housing ordinances be found substantially consistent with Princeton’s Master Plan, including proposals allowing up to 191 units at 457 North Harrison Street, 25 units at 145 Witherspoon Street, and 30 units on Spruce Street. Each identified proposal requires at least 20% affordable housing, and the recorded recommendations passed without opposition.

These actions support moving several affordable housing zoning proposals forward, but they are recommendations to the governing body rather than final development approvals. The proposals would convert or reuse underutilized sites for multifamily housing while preserving or adding affordable units. The Board also approved the Cannon Dial Elm Club site-development application at 21 Prospect Avenue with conditions; the specific conditions are not fully detailed in the provided excerpts.
